Copyright Registration Services

Copyright is a legal right that protects original creative works such as books, articles, website content, software code, logo artwork, photographs, videos, music, films, sound recordings, designs, brochures, architectural drawings, training materials, digital content, and other intellectual creations. It gives the creator or owner exclusive legal rights to use, reproduce, publish, distribute, license, and protect the work from unauthorized copying or misuse.

Copyright protection arises automatically for original works under the Copyright Act, 1957, but formal registration creates stronger legal evidence of ownership and makes enforcement much easier in case of disputes, piracy, infringement, copying, or commercial misuse. The Indian Copyright Office confirms that copyright registration is handled under the Copyright Act, 1957 and related Rules.

The registration process is generally filed through Form XIV along with the Statement of Particulars and Statement of Further Particulars. Separate applications are required for each individual work. The Copyright Office FAQ specifically states that each work requires a separate application and the prescribed fee must be paid with the application.

Government fee depends on the type of work. For literary, dramatic, musical, or artistic works, the official fee is generally ₹500 per work. Where a literary or artistic work is used or capable of being used in relation to goods or services under Section 45, the fee is generally ₹2,000 per work. Cinematograph film registration is generally ₹5,000 and sound recording registration is generally ₹2,000 per work.

The standard process usually includes:

  • Copyright Search and Work Review
  • Form XIV Preparation
  • Statement of Particulars Drafting
  • Statement of Further Particulars Preparation
  • Document Verification
  • Government Fee Payment
  • Filing on Copyright Portal
  • Diary Number Generation
  • 30-Day Objection Waiting Period
  • Examination by Copyright Office
  • Hearing Support (if objection arises)
  • Registration Certificate Issuance

The Copyright Office process includes a 30-day waiting period after diary number generation for objections before further examination proceeds.

Common documents required include:

  • Copy of Original Work (PDF / JPG / MP3 / Video / Source Code etc.)
  • Applicant PAN Card
  • Aadhaar / Identity Proof
  • Address Proof
  • Author Details
  • Owner Details (if different from author)
  • NOC from Author (if applicable)
  • NOC from Publisher (if applicable)
  • Power of Attorney (if filed through authorized representative)
  • Business Registration Documents where applicable

For software registration, commonly the first 10 pages and last 10 pages of source code may be required with confidential portions masked where necessary.

Copyright is different from Trademark:

  • Copyright protects creative expression and original content
  • Trademark protects brand identity such as name, logo, and slogan

For logo protection, both copyright and trademark registration may be important depending on business needs.
